1 Combining Like Terms and using the Distributive Property

2 Vocabulary Expression – number sentence that does NOT have an equal sign Ex. 4x – 6x + 5 Coefficient - Number used to multiply a variable ex. 4x – 6x Term – Each part of an expression, separated by a + or - sign Ex. 4x – 6x + 5 Like Term – Terms that have the same variable Ex. 4x – 6x Constant – A specific value that does not change Ex. 4x – 6x + 5

10 The Distributive Property
The distributive property lets you multiply a sum by multiplying each addend separately and then add the products. 8( 5x – 3)

12 Distributive Property
To multiply a sum by a number, multiply each addend by the number outside the parenthesis 3(20+15) = 3x x 15 a(b+c) = a x b + a x c

14 Generate an expression equivalent to 2(k + 7) using the distributive property.
2 · k + 2 · 7 2k + 14

15 Generate an expression equivalent to 9(x + 4) using the distributive property.
9 · x + 9 · 4 9x + 36

16 Generate an expression equivalent to -5(x - 4) using the distributive property.
-5 · x + -5 · -4 -5x + 20
